RSS Guard supports labels, which you are required to create with a right-click on the labels folder in the left sidebar. The functionality is only for experienced users, and you should start by reading the documentation on the project’s website. The ability to scrape websites is another useful feature of RSS Guard. There are options for testing the JavaScript code. The application does not include any pre-installed filters for users to use.įilters can be applied to all feeds or just a few. To set them up, go to Settings > Keyboard shortcuts.Īrticle filters are supported by RSS Guard, although they are only relevant to users who are familiar with JavaScript, as it is required to write filters. Many keyboard shortcuts are supported by the application, however, not all of them are mapped by default. The article search tool looks for the term in the feed articles’ title and content. RSS Guard has a search feature that allows you to find material in feeds or articles. A double-click opens the article in the default web browser there are also options to alter the browser and add external URL-supporting applications. With a single click, you may adjust the importance of articles and, if desired, make them unread again using the right-click context menu. When articles are selected, they are immediately marked as read. They can also alter fonts and other interface-specific options there. Users who prefer a dark theme or a different icon set can do so in the user interface settings. There are options to switch to a three-column layout, which may be beneficial if you’re using a widescreen display. The View menu contains settings for hiding non-essential interface elements, such as the status bar and toolbars.

You may also use the right-click menu to get updates from particular feeds. When you click the “get all feeds” button, data from all feeds is retrieved.
